This action-packed event spans two days, beginning on Saturday, June 20th, with the 29th Clubsport-Jugend-Motocross. Young talents will compete in 50cc, 65cc, 85cc, and the exciting UFO-Klasse 125cc. The day also features rounds of the Baden-Württembergische Motocross-Meisterschaft, ensuring competitive racing throughout. As the sun sets, join the free warm-up party to mingle with riders and fans. Sunday, June 21st, brings the 53rd Clubsport-Motocross Schweighausen, showcasing Senior and Hobby classes, more championship races, and the inaugural Alemannen-Pokal open class with a substantial prize pool. Details
- Date: June 20-21, 2026
- Time: Saturday from 10:00 AM, Sunday from 10:00 AM
- Venue: Pfingstberg, 77978 Schuttertal, Germany
- Organizer: MSC Alemannorum e.V.
- Entry: Saturday: Free for children/youth, €6.00 for adults (weekend pass available). Sunday: Free for children under 6, €6.00 for students up to 15, €13.00 for adults. Parking included.
- Highlights: 29th Jugend-Motocross, 53rd Clubsport-Motocross, Baden-Württembergische Motocross-Meisterschaft, Alemannen-Pokal with €7,500 prize money, Saturday warm-up party (free entry).
